    Hi and welcome!

    Anything with 510/eGo threading will technically fit it. If you are not looking at VV batteries it is probably best to avoid dual coil tanks as your battery will work super hard to try and power it. Also consider how big the tanks are, many larger capacity tanks are very top heavy on that style of battery as Spazmelda pointed out.

    Make sure you order a spare battery at least for each of you also. If something happens to one or it dies at an inopportune time - you will be grateful to have the back up so that you arent tempted to smoke. The rule in general around here is BACKUPS. :) Get backups to backup the backups if you are able.

    I'd go ahead and pick up some replacement coils. The evod tank and the protanks use the same type coils, so that can be convenient.

    I agree with the poster who suggested finding a local vape shop to test liquids. That can really help save money as far as buying lots of samples you end up hating. Even if the liquids are a bit more expensive at a B&M, it can still be cheaper than buying 10-15 samples and only liking 2-3 of them. If you don't have a B&M, then find online vendors who offer sample packs. I'd recommend getting a few sample packs from different vendors and not just limiting yourself to one vendor.
